Document the status of the invasion biology corpus on Wikidata at regular intervals #57

Open Daniel-Mietchen opened 2 years ago

Daniel-Mietchen commented 2 years ago

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e. It is non-trivial to visualize the progress of community curation on a dataset like the invasion biology subset of Wikidata.

Describe the solution you'd like

I would like to see us take snapshots of the results of in-scope queries (as per https://www.wikidata.org/wiki/Wikidata:WikiProject_Invasion_biology ) and to archive both the queries and the query results at that timepoint, as demoed for clinical trials at https://doi.org/10.5281/zenodo.6317047 .

Describe alternatives you've considered

An alternative would be to adapt Wikidata-generic approaches like Wikidated (cf. https://scholia.toolforge.org/work/Q111528580 )

Additional context

While this tickets is mainly about the data side of the project, there could be something similar also for the software, e.g. as discussed for Scholia at https://github.com/WDscholia/scholia/issues/964 .
